Arizona Deer — Unit 45B
Arizona Unit 45B covers 266,836 acres and lies 65 miles north-east of Yuma. 100% of it is public land, mostly wildlife refuge (100%). In 2025, 98 people hunted deer here and took 11 — 11% of them killed something. The 2026 draw put up 25 tags here for 31 first-choice applicants, and the last tag went to someone with 3 points.

What these columns mean
- Your odds —
- the share of applicants at your point level who drew this tag in the 2026 draw. Not a forecast: quotas and demand move every year.
- The badge —
- plain language for that number. Likely draw 75% or better · Real chance 40%+ · Long shot 15%+ · Point builder below that, so you are applying mainly to bank a point · Undersubscribed means fewer first-choice applicants than tags, so everyone who applied drew.
- As 2nd choice —
- Arizona lets you name more than one hunt on the application. Miss on your first choice and you go into the pot for whatever tags are left, alongside everyone else's second choices. Points never help a lower choice, so this number is the same whatever you have banked — it is usually worth naming a hunt that goes undersubscribed.
- Points needed —
- the lowest point total that still got a tag in the 2026 draw, and how that cut has moved since the earliest draw we hold.
- Tags / applicants —
- tags on offer and first-choice applicants for them, as the agency published them. Under five tags we print counts instead of a percentage, because one applicant either way swings it.

How the hunting has gone
What Arizona Game & Fish Department publishes for this area after each season — harvest statistics for everyone who hunted it, not draw odds and not a forecast. Arizona Game & Fish Department publishes these per hunt rather than per unit; the rows below add its own figures together, since a hunter holds one tag for the species in a season. Arizona's figures come from AZGFD's post-season hunter questionnaire - survey estimates carrying a 90% confidence interval and a return count, not a census of animals checked in.
All deer
| Season | Hunters | Harvest | Success |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2025 | 98 | 11 | 11% |
| 2024 | 66 | 23 | 35% |
| 2023 | 110 | 19 | 17% |
| 2022 | 56 | 0 | 0% |
| 2021 | 157 | 13 | 8% |
| 2020 | 109 | 31 | 28% |
| 2019 | 118 | 29 | 25% |
